SB544 • 2025

Requires vaporizing detection devices to be installed in certain areas of high schools that have 1,000 or more enrolled students.

Official Summary Text

Digest: The Act requires vaping detectors to be installed in certain high schools. (Flesch Readability Score: 67.7).
Requires vaporizing detection devices to be installed in certain areas of high schools that have 1,000 or more enrolled students.
Relating to: Relating to the installation of vaporizing detection devices in high schools.
